When is the optimal time of year for tree pruning?
The ideal timing for pruning will differ depending on the sort of tree and where you reside. In general, it's best to have a tree pruner cut back your trees throughout the dormant time of year.
Winter is a great time for tree upkeep since the rest of your backyard should not call for any type of focus throughout that time. Thinning trees before the spring sprouting and growing period will enable your trees to shoot out and also flourish perfectly.
There is typically not a problem doing tree maintenance throughout the springtime and summertime as well, especially if there is any type of dead wood, disease,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Pruning
Palm trees need a great deal of care while pruning. Cutting the limbs at the incorrect time can leave them helpless against infections. Palm trees ought to be pruned when the older growth has turned brown and died. This is usually a couple of times in a year.
Staying up to date with routine maintenance is important for avoiding damage and injuries from hard and heavy falling palm branches.
Pine Tree Pruning
The very best time to cut back your pine trees is during the very first part of spring, however if at any time you discover dying or unhealthy branches, it's a good idea to deal with those.
Applying correct pruning techniques is truly necessary.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is really a bad idea due to the fact that it can stop the branch from growing entirely. That can leave the branch stunted and off balance permanently.
In the spring when the pine tree begins to sprout out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and thick growth that is particularly attractive.
